When “Trust Us” Isn’t Enough: Government Surveillance in a Post-Snowden World

from Open Society Foundations Podcast · host Open Society Foundations

Open Society Fellow Chris Soghoian explains the ominous implications of widespread government surveillance. Speakers: Stephen Hubbell, Chris Soghoian. (Recorded: Jan 9, 2014)
